Professional Installation

The Autowatch Ghost immobiliser protects your car against key hacking attacks, cloning and relay attacks. The system is connected directly to the ECU of your vehicle and protected by a PIN code you set. It's inaccessible to thieves using scanners for diagnostics or other modern methods, and is unable to be disabled through circuit cuts.

The system is easy to use, but professional installation is advised to ensure a perfect connection to the ECU of your vehicle. Installers who are approved by Thatcham can assist you with the installation and programing of your Ghost system. They can also recommend an alarm or tracking system to complete the security package for your vehicle.

The first step is to disconnect the battery to prevent the possibility of airbag deployment and ghost 11 Immobiliser short circuits. After this is completed, the installer can safely begin work. Hand tools are the most basic to be used to ensure precise connections. A multimeter can be used to check electrical values. Insulation tape and cable ties are also vital for protecting connections and keeping wiring tidy. The Ghost Immobiliser user's manual will give specific instructions that are tailored to your model.

It is essential to choose the right grounding spot that is free of paint or debris during installation. The installer must be sure that the immobiliser's CAN H and CAN L wires are connected to the correct ports on your vehicle's ECU. Based on the model, these wires could require soldering or plugged into. Using a quality connector is recommended to ensure a durable and secure connection.

Once the install is complete After the installation is complete, the customer can turn on the Transport Mode. This permits mechanics or valet parking to use the vehicle, without having to know the pin code. To do this, the user must hit the button for service on the dashboard five times in a matter of 2 seconds. The system will confirm this by displaying five indicators.

Wiring

The Ghost Immobiliser is a cutting-edge security system that's designed to prevent vehicle theft. It connects directly to the vehicle's CAN bus network and communicates with the ECU and ECU, making it virtually undetectable to your car. Ghost Immobiliser doesn't interfere with the factory settings of your car, unlike other aftermarket systems that require the removal of circuit elements.

It's also totally undetectable by thieves using diagnostic scanning devices. The system does not send or receive radio frequency signals and instead uses CAN data for communication with your ECU. It doesn't require any modifications to your existing key fobs.

To make use of the Ghost Immobiliser simply switch on the ignition of your car and enter your disarm sequence (either one or two buttons). The indicator will flash two times to verify that you have entered the correct code. After this, you can start your vehicle and leave in peace.

Once installed, the Ghost Immobiliser protects your car against key cloning or hacking while also protecting its value. In Transport Mode, you can temporarily disable the Ghost Immobiliser if you need to hand your car over for service or valet park.
